[0001] This utility model relates to the field of spraying drones, and in particular to a 360° automatic adjustment device for the nozzle angle of a spraying drone. Background Technology

[0002] Drone spraying operations have been widely used in fields such as agricultural plant protection and environmental disinfection. Drones consist of a flight platform, control system, power system, spraying system or spreading system. They are used for pesticide spraying, seed and fertilizer spreading, etc., through remote control by ground personnel or autonomous flight control. Traditional drone nozzles have fixed angles, which makes it difficult to meet the needs of complex operation scenarios. Therefore, developing a device that can automatically adjust the nozzle angle is of great practical significance.

[0003] In the process of developing this application, the inventors discovered the following problems with the prior art:

[0004] In existing technologies, operators often need to frequently adjust the drone's flight attitude to meet the requirement of uniform spraying. This not only increases the difficulty of operation and reduces work efficiency, but may also cause the drone to be damaged by collision due to improper operation. In addition, in existing technologies, the nozzles are usually connected to the drone by directly fixing them to the lower end of the drone with bolts, which makes it inconvenient to adjust the number of nozzles according to usage requirements.

[0005] Therefore, those skilled in the art have provided a device for automatically adjusting the 360° nozzle angle of a drone spraying application to solve the problems mentioned in the background art. Utility Model Content

[0006] The purpose of this invention is to address the shortcomings of existing technologies by proposing a 360° automatic adjustment device for the nozzle angle of a drone spraying equipment. This device enables quick adjustment of the number of nozzles and adjusts the spraying angle, thereby reducing the operational burden on operators.

[0017] This utility model has the following beneficial effects:

[0018] 1. This utility model proposes a 360° automatic adjustment device for the spray nozzle angle of a drone. Starting a primary motor drives a rotating shaft, which in turn drives a small gear through a longitudinal bevel gear at one end of the shaft's outer wall and a meshing transverse bevel gear. This small gear then drives a large gear, which in turn rotates the inner and outer cylinders, thus achieving a 360° adjustment of the spray nozzle angle. Simultaneously, a secondary motor drives a fixed frame to rotate, further adjusting the spray elevation angle, thus achieving automatic adjustment of the spray nozzle angle and reducing the operator's workload.

[0019] 2. This utility model proposes a 360° automatic adjustment device for the nozzle angle of a drone spraying device. By rotating the fixing nut, the nozzle can be removed from the outer wall of the connecting rod. Then, the limiting plate can be slid to one side to separate it from the outer wall of the connecting rod. At this time, the connecting plate can be folded under the action of gravity. Then, the fixing seat at the upper end of the nozzle to be added is sleeved on the appropriate position of the outer wall of the fixing frame. After that, the two bolts on both sides of the lower end face of the fixing seat are rotated so that the two bolts can be threaded into the two screw holes located at the corresponding positions to fix the position of the fixing seat, thereby achieving a convenient adjustment effect on the number of spray heads. [0030] Specifically, the clamping mechanism 2 inside the fixing plate 3 enables quick installation and connection between the device and different types of drones. The transmission mechanism 16 can adjust the spray angle of the water nozzle 12, thereby reducing the operator's workload. The buffer mechanism 19 can buffer the vibration caused by the drone's flight attitude when adjusting the spray angle of the water nozzle 12, thereby improving the spraying stability. The rotating fixing frame 11 can adjust the spray elevation angle of the multiple water nozzles 12 fixed on its outer wall.

[0045] Working principle: Two support plates 201 are respectively snapped onto both sides of the drone. Then, rotating the bidirectional screw 204 causes the two support plates 201 to move in opposite directions to clamp the sides of the drone. Then, rotating the two threaded rods 203 causes the two clamping plates 202 to move downwards to clamp and fix the top of the drone. During the spraying process, the first motor 4 is started to drive the rotating shaft 1601 to rotate. This allows the transverse bevel gear 1604 and the longitudinal bevel gear 1605 to drive the large gear 1602 and the small gear 1603 to rotate, which in turn drives the inner cylinder and the outer cylinder 7 to rotate. This allows for the adjustment of the horizontal spray angle of the water nozzle 12 on the outer wall of the fixing frame 11. Simultaneously, the fixed frame 11 can be vertically flipped directly by the second motor 15, thereby adjusting the spray angle of the spray head 12. At the same time, when the aircraft vibrates during flight or spray angle adjustment, the spring 1902 and connecting arm 1904 inside the buffer mechanism 19 can provide a buffering effect to ensure spray stability. Meanwhile, the fixed nut 9 is rotated to remove it from the outer wall of the connecting rod 8, and then the limiting plate 10 is slid to one side to remove it from the outer wall of the connecting rod 8. At this time, the connecting plate 14 flips under the action of gravity, and the fixed seat 13 on the outer wall of the fixed frame 11 can be added. This allows for quick adjustment of the number of spray heads 12 according to actual usage needs.
